Human Lymphocyte Antigen (HLA) system has a central role in the immune response. HLA proteins present peptides to T cells and B cells/plasma cells can produce antibodies against HLA proteins. Therefore, HLA antigens and antibodies are the main barrier in solid organ transplantation (SOT). This presentation describes the basic characteristics of the HLA system (like structure and function) and how HLA antibodies are detected in the laboratory. This presentation also describes an overview of the SOT system in USA, from the role of the HLA laboratory to the organ allocation process.
